Reinforced Polythene Building Membranes
Heavy duty gas barrier DPM
Radon & Methane barrier
Accreditation : BRE 040/97
Grade 871 is suitable for use as a radon and methane barrier, and as a damp-proof membrane in
floor constructions. It can be installed over or under concrete ground floor slabs with or without
insulation.It can also be used for remedial work and with timber or concrete suspended floors.
Construction
Grade 871 is a multilayer composite membrane with polythene for toughness and water
resistance, a multifilament polyester reinforcement for high tear resistance and an aluminium foil
core for outstanding barrier performance. Grade 871 is mid-green one side and silver reflective on
the reverse side.

Fixing/Sitework
Store rolls on sides under cover until needed. Cover entire site with membrane, overlapping joints
100mm and sealing with a suitable butyl double-sided adhesive tape. Seal around all services
through the membrane with a suitable flashing tape, or use "top hat" seals. Carry edges of
membrane under DPC of external walls. Repair or replace any damaged areas before covering
with concrete.
Please note: the performance of the radon/methane barrier will only be effective if the membrane is
effectively gas-tight. Inadequate seams and poorly sealed service entries will allow radon/methane
into the completed building.
